Understanding Lottery Odds


When you choose to buy lottery tickets, it’s important to comprehend the odds linked to each game. Different lotteries have different odds of winning based on the number of possible number combinations. For example, a lottery that requires choose six numbers from a pool of forty-nine has far lower odds than a game where you only have to select four numbers from a pool of ten. Understanding these odds aids you to make informed choices about the tickets to buy.


Additionally critical aspect to consider is the structure of the lottery prize payouts. In some lotteries, the jackpot grows over time until someone wins, which can create alluring large prizes but also means the odds of winning are significantly lower. Alternatively, other lotteries offer more smaller prizes, which may be more achievable. By evaluating both the odds and the potential payouts, you can tailor your ticket purchasing strategy to fit your risk tolerance.

Selecting Your Digits Wisely


When it comes to buying lottery tickets, the numbers you choose can greatly impact your chances of winning. หวยออนไลน์ Numerous players have their own strategies, either they rely on personal significance like birthdays or anniversaries, or they opt for random selections. While there is no foolproof method, a thoughtful approach to number selection can enhance your experience and keep you engaged in the game.


A popular strategy is to analyze past winning numbers. Certain players analyze trends or frequency charts to identify numbers that are drawn frequently. Nonetheless, it’s important to keep in mind that lottery draws are random, and past results do not affect future outcomes. Still, this analysis can create a sense of control and involvement that many players enjoy, adding an element of strategy to the thrill of buying lottery tickets.


An additional approach is to consider playing a mix of high and low numbers or even odd and even numbers. This mixed method may provide a diverse set of choices, making it unlikely that one will share your prize with others who selected the same common numbers.
